COLUMBIANA – Main Street in downtown Columbiana will once again host a car show benefiting the Shelby Humane Society on Saturday, May 14.

The second annual Tails & Tires Car Show will feature a variety of cars on display and numerous animals available for onsite adoption from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m.

“One hundred percent of the proceeds go to the Shelby Humane Society,” event organizer Glenda Roberson said, noting general admission to the event is free and open to the public. “Any tax-deductible donations will be accepted at the event.”

Anyone interested in participating in the car show may register through the day of the event. Registration on May 14 will start at 8 a.m. in front of the Alabama Power Appliance Center in Columbiana.

The registration fee for the first car is $20. The fee for each additional car is $15.

To register before the event, contact Roberson at glrobers@southernco.com or 337-5083.

The following awards will be given: Mayor’s Choice, Best in Show, Best in Show Runner-Up, Best Custom, Best Original and Best Street Rod.

“We had 36 cars the first year, and I’m looking for a whole lot more this year,” Roberson said.

In addition, the event will include live music by The Last Chance Band, door prizes, food and arts and crafts vendors.

Event sponsors are Alabama Power and Piggly Wiggly. Roberson acknowledged her fellow employees at the E.C. Gaston Steam Plant in Wilsonville for their help in organizing the event.

Those who attend are welcome to bring their pets, Roberson said, adding, “It’s a family and pet friendly event.”
